15-feet-long python rescued in Odisha’s Keonjhar district: Watch

Anandapur: A fifteen feet long huge python was rescued in Keonjhar district of Odisha on Friday. The huge reptile was rescued by the locals from the bank of the River Sendhei.

As we can see in the video, five to six people also felt it difficult to carry the huge python.

As per reports, some people from the Kantarohi village in Anandapur block of this district had gone near the Sendhei River for grazing goats. There they found the huge python which had swallowed a goat.

Within no time the villagers caught the gigantic reptile and later handed over it to the Deogan Forest Division. A lot of people flocked to the spot to witness the very long python.
